Quick Chapter Recap — Quadratic Equations
A quadratic equation in one variable is any equation that can be written in the standard form ax² + bx + c = 0, where a, b, c are real numbers and a ≠ 0. The NCERT Class 10 Mathematics curriculum emphasizes three solution methods: factorisation (splitting the middle term or using identities), completing the square (converting to perfect-square form), and the quadratic formula x = [-b ± √(b²-4ac)] / 2a. The discriminant D = b² - 4ac determines the nature of roots: D > 0 gives two distinct real roots, D = 0 gives two equal real roots, and D < 0 means no real roots exist. Understanding when to apply each method saves time in board exams. Factorisation works well when roots are rational, while the quadratic formula is universal. Mastering these techniques ensures you can handle any question from MCQs to lengthy application problems.
- Standard form: ax² + bx + c = 0, where a ≠ 0
- Three solution methods: factorisation, completing the square, quadratic formula
- Discriminant D = b² - 4ac determines nature of roots
- D > 0 → two distinct real roots; D = 0 → two equal roots; D < 0 → no real roots
- The sum of roots is -b/a and the product of roots is c/a

Section A — Multiple Choice Questions (1 mark each)

- Q1. The standard form of the equation (x - 3)² = 25 is: (a) x² - 6x + 9 = 0 (b) x² - 6x - 16 = 0 (c) x² + 6x - 16 = 0 (d) x² - 6x + 34 = 0
- Q2. The roots of x² + 7x + 12 = 0 are: (a) -3, -4 (b) 3, 4 (c) -3, 4 (d) 3, -4
- Q3. If the discriminant of ax² + bx + c = 0 is zero, then the roots are: (a) real and distinct (b) real and equal (c) imaginary (d) cannot be determined
- Q4. The quadratic formula for ax² + bx + c = 0 is: (a) x = [-b ± √(b² + 4ac)] / 2a (b) x = [b ± √(b² - 4ac)] / 2a (c) x = [-b ± √(b² - 4ac)] / 2a (d) x = [-b ± √(4ac - b²)] / 2a
- Q5. Which of the following is NOT a quadratic equation? (a) x² - 5x + 6 = 0 (b) 3x + 7 = 0 (c) 2x² = 8 (d) (x + 2)² = x² + 4x + 4
- Q6. The nature of roots of 2x² - 3x + 5 = 0 is: (a) two distinct real roots (b) two equal real roots (c) no real roots (d) one real root

Which solution method should I use for quadratic equations in the exam?+
Use factorisation when roots appear rational and factors are easy to spot; otherwise, apply the quadratic formula for guaranteed results. Completing the square is useful for deriving the formula or specific proof questions.
How do I interpret the discriminant quickly during the exam?+
Calculate D = b² - 4ac. If D > 0, two distinct real roots; D = 0, two equal real roots; D < 0, no real roots. This saves time in MCQs and fills the nature-of-roots short-answer questions accurately.
